Output 66df896f889b4d4fb51bd6e60693596cd35e4f71fd21040119ee66dcce5e1f95:7

value
179521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ef087d70be07ed7de2b67e6b1b925bb5019de37e OP_EQUAL
address
3PUubHbJF5JDZCmgQqdxTVjoAbM85MZzP3
transaction
66df896f889b4d4fb51bd6e60693596cd35e4f71fd21040119ee66dcce5e1f95
confirmations
265076
spent
true